When does NHL season start? Key dates for 2024-25
View
Date:2025-04-11 17:53:06
The NHL will start gearing up for the 2024-25 regular season with the Florida Panthers trying to defend their first championship after making two consecutive trips to the Stanley Cup Final.
That follows a busy offseason in which nine coaches were hired or had their interim tags removed, prominent goalies were traded and free agents found new homes.
NHL rookie tournaments open on Friday and Saturday, followed by training camps, and preseason games will start on Sept. 21. The regular season will start in Europe on Oct. 4 and in North America on Oct. 8.
Here are the key dates for the NHL's 2024-25 regular season:
When is the first day of the NHL season?
The 2024-25 NHL regular season will start in Europe on Oct. 4-5 when the New Jersey Devils and Buffalo Sabres play on back-to-back nights in Prague, Czechia.
When is the first day of the NHL season in North America?
The 2024-25 NHL regular season will start in North America with three games on Oct. 8.
When do the Florida Panthers raise their Stanley Cup banner?
The defending champions' home opener is Oct. 8 against the Boston Bruins (7 p.m. ET), the team they knocked out in the playoffs the past two seasons.
When is the Utah Hockey Club's home opener?
The Salt Lake City-based team, which acquired the assets of the Arizona Coyotes, also is playing on Oct. 8 (10 p.m. ET), hosting rookie of the year Connor Bedard and the Chicago Blackhawks.
The St. Louis Blues visit the Seattle Kraken in the early game on Oct. 8 (4:30 p.m. ET). All games will be broadcast on ESPN.
What day will all NHL teams be in action?
All 32 teams are playing on Oct. 22. Just as with last season, the start times of this year's 16 games will be staggered every 15 to 30 minutes between 6 p.m. ET and 11 p.m. ET.
When is the NHL's second set of games in Europe?
The Dallas Stars and Panthers will play in Tampere, Finland, on Nov. 1-2.
When is the Stanley Cup Final rematch?
The runner-up Edmonton Oilers will host the champion Panthers on Dec. 16. The teams also will play on Feb. 27 in Sunrise, Florida.
When is the Winter Classic?
The Winter Classic will be held on Dec. 31 (5 p.m. ET) at Chicago's Wrigley Field between the Blackhawks and Blues. The Winter Classic was also played at the Chicago Cubs' stadium in 2009.
When is the NHL All-Star Game?
There is no All-Star Game this season. It will be replaced by the 4 Nations Face-Off, which will serve as an appetizer for NHL players' return to the Olympics at the 2026 Winter Games in Milan and Cortina d'Ampezzo, Italy.
When is the 4 Nations Face-Off?
It will be held from Feb. 12-20 in Boston and Montreal and will feature NHL players from the United States, Canada, Sweden and Finland. Each country has named its first six players and the rest will be announced from Nov. 29 to Dec. 2.
When is the NHL's second outdoor game?
The Columbus Blue Jackets will host the Detroit Red Wings at Ohio Stadium, home of Ohio State's football team, on March 1.
When is the NHL trade deadline?
That hasn't been settled yet, but it's expected to be in early March.
When does the NHL regular season end?
The regular season is scheduled to end on April 17 with six games.
